Kamalatmika Mahavidya : One of 10 Tantrik Goddesses Of Ancient India

Kamalatmika is the 10th Number Mahavidya in the 10 Mahavidya series of Shaktism ( A sect of ancient India dedicated to worshiping Energy or Shakti).

10 Mahavidyas are incredibly secretive goddesses in Tantra, described to be the 10 aspects of Adishakti or the Primordial Energy. These manifestations range from the most benign and benevolent forms to incredibly ruinous and sinister appearing aspects of Energy manifested to carry out various activities of the universe. The word Maha-vidya means great wisdom, something that transcends the knowledge acquired through 5 senses. Mahavidyas are described as the “Sarvaartha-sadhikas” the ones who can carry out any and all events in the universe and hence they are omnipotent aspects of Energy.

Today we are discussing a rather benevolent and auspicious Mahavidya of Divine Mother known as Kamalatmika. Kamalatmika word means - The soul/ essence of Lotus. Here the word lotus is not only referring to the flower lotus, but in the spiritual language of Tantra Lotus means the innate potency of everything to bloom and blossom into something enthralling and transcendental.

Goddess Kamalatmika is that innate energy within you me and every other entity in the universe to bloom into something greater and more prosperous.
As per the esoteric knowledge of Tantra, everything in the universe has this innate ability, however, the difference lies in the realization of the truth. When you realize this tremendous primordial force within you, your life will inevitably change into something unimaginably excellent.

Iconographical Representation - Lotus is also called - Pankaj means born out of Mud. Loutus flowers can bloom in the most ravenous conditions of rotting and decaying ponds full of mud. However, it is wise enough to draw its nutrition from such an adverse environment and bloom in its full glory and beauty, rising above the mud. Kamalatmika represents exactly this ability which is innate in all organisms.

Every adverse situation which befalls your life is like the Panka (mud) and with the essence of Kamalatmika, you can derive your resources from those environments as well and rise in power and prosperity like a lotus. Lotus leaves and petals are also infamous for secreting a substance that makes it impossible for water and mud to stick to them or touch their inner layers. Similarly one must learn how to be untouched by the external environment like a lotus which is untouched by the mud it grows in.

Every potential to bloom in life is depicted in the form of a Lotus flower including the 7 chakras. In the secret symbolism of Tantra, the ancient Gurus have given the indication that each of these energy centers has the ability to blossom your life into new realms. Hence each chakra is shown as a different petalled lotus ( each petal has a tantric symbolism which we will discuss some other day ).

Mahavidya Kamalatmika hence rules all such domains of life where you can bloom yourself into a much more advanced and prosperous state. The human brain itself is shown as a 1000 petalled lotus in Tantra indicating the possibility of growth there and the governance of Kamalatmika there.

One must remember every adversity and every situation which life throws at you has the potential to bloom you into an excellent being and that potential is innate within you.The person who masters this art gains the epitome of success and luxury in life, and hence Kamalatmika is also the highest manifestation of material success and luxury.

One can also see elephants in the background pouring the Amrit ( Sacred Exiler Of Life) which indicates divine blessings and transcendental knowledge (Amrit) which this Goddess can provide you through her sadhana. The elephants pour the Amrit over her from all the 4 directions showing abundance and success in all domains of life.
